Digital Voice Advanced on a 3rd party router

Hi everyone; I have a question or two. So I'm a 1GB Fibre customer. I've upgraded my Smart Hub 2 to a Xiaomi Wireless Mesh. Since doing this I can't use my WiFi phone. Is it possible to add the Smart hub as a repeater with the sole purpose of using the phone? Thanks in advance.

The SH2 has to be the first device in line ( so connected to the ONT ) but you can connect your own mesh after the SH2 , you can’t have the SH2 second in line if you want your phone service ( DV ) to work

"Would I need to keep the WiFi open on the SH2 for the phone"

No, the DV connection on the SH2 does not need the hub's WiFi to be on for it to work. Also, any digital phones that wirelessly connect to the SH2 don't need the hub's WiFi to be on either, because they connect via DECT.
